| All-State Honors for PSU Class | ||||

Currently the Nittany Lions have four Pennsylvania propsects in their Class of 2006, all of whom were honored as first team All-State selections for their performances this year on the field. | |||
|
The Associated Press has named their 2005 All-State team selections, which includes members of Penn State's Class of 2006. Class AAAA Travis McBride, McKeesport Area S.H.S. Although the 6-foot-1, 195 pound McBride was the top running back in the WPIAL with a career average of 11 yards per carry, he was selected to the first team squad at defensive back, the position PSU recruited him for. Tom McEowen, Neshaminy H.S. The 6-foot-4, 275 pound McEowen anchors the first team defensive line thanks to his three sacks and 74 tackles this season. Class AAA Jared Odrick, Lebanon H.S. The 6-foot-6, 285 pound lineman was a first team selection for the Pennsylvania squad, and was also selected to USA Today's All-USA First Team. Class AA Abe Koroma, Milton S. Hershey H.S. The 6-foot-3, 285 pound lineman was a first team selection. He was also named to the Capital Division's first team offensive line and defensive line and was honored as the division's defensive MVP. Other prospects of PSU interest selected to All-State teams in the Keystone State include LeSean McCoy (Class AAAA first team), Pat Bostick (Class AAAA second team), Elijah Fields (Class A Player of the Year) and David Posluszny (Class AAA second team). -30- |
